13 is 26 percent of 50.
To determine the number that 13 is 26% of, we can set up the equation:
13 = 0.26x
Here, x represents the unknown number we are trying to find. To solve for x, we divide both sides of the equation by 0.26:
13 / 0.26 = x
Simplifying the expression, we have:
x = 50
Therefore, 13 is 26% of 50.
To understand this calculation, we recognize that 26% can be expressed as the decimal 0.26. Multiplying 0.26 by the unknown number x gives us 13, which means that 13 is 26% of x. By dividing both sides of the equation by 0.26, we isolate x and find that it is equal to 50.

Abscissa is the value of the x coordinate while ordinate is the y coordinate. In quadrant I, the ordered pair is (positive abscissa, positive ordinate.
Quadrant II has negative abscissa and positive ordinate.
Quadrant III is both negative abscissa and negative ordinate.
Lastly, Quadrant IV has positive abscissa and negative ordinate.
